模型()


模型()

模型(name="", env=defaultEnv)

模型的构造函数。

参数:

的名字:新型号名称。请注意,的名字将以ASCII字符串的形式存储。因此,名字就像“一个< span > < /美元跨度> {\ rightarrow} < span > < / span >美元B”将产生一个错误,因为< span > < /美元跨度> {\ rightarrow} < span > < / span >美元'不能表示为ASCII字符。还请注意,强烈反对包含空格的名称,因为不能将它们写入LP格式文件。

env:创建模型的环境。创建您的环境(使用Env构造函数)可以使您对Gurobi许可有更多的控制,但它会使您的程序更加复杂。使用默认环境,除非您知道需要控制自己的环境。

返回值:

新模型对象。模型最初不包含变量或约束。

使用示例:

m = Model("NewModel") x0 = m. addvar () env = env ("my.log") m2 = Model("NewModel2", env)